Finding GCD of 933, 342, 152, 225 using Prime Factorization

Given Input Data is 933, 342, 152, 225

Make a list of Prime Factors of all the given numbers initially

Prime Factorization of 933 is 3 x 311

Prime Factorization of 342 is 2 x 3 x 3 x 19

Prime Factorization of 152 is 2 x 2 x 2 x 19

Prime Factorization of 225 is 3 x 3 x 5 x 5

The above numbers do not have any common prime factor. So GCD is 1
